编程包含哪些 (编程包含哪些内容)
创始人
2026-05-21 19:04:48
0

编程关键包含以下内容:

1. 编程言语和工具:编程触及多种编程言语的把握与经常使用,如Java、Python、C++等。

每种言语都有其特定的语法规定和用途。

此外,开发者还须要相熟各种开发工具,如编译器、集成开发环境(IDE)等,它们可以协助开发者更高效地启动编程上班。

2. 算法和数据结构:编程中十分关键的内容是算法和数据结构。

算法是处置疑问的步骤和流程,而数据结构则是如何组织和存储数据的形式。

把握各种算法和数据结构可以协助开发者编写出更高效、更稳固的代码。

3. 软件开发流程:除了编程言语和工具的经常使用,编程还触及软件开发的全环节,包含需求剖析、系统设计、编码、测试、部署等。

开发者须要了解这些流程,并能够在团队中单干成功软件开发义务。

4. 软件调试和测试:编程环节中不免会产生失误和bug,因此开发者须要把握调试和测试的技艺。

这包含经常使用调试工具来定位和处置疑问,以及经过测试来确保软件的稳固性和品质。

5. 版本控制:在团队开发中,版本控制是十分关键的技艺。

经过经常使用版本控制系统(如Git),可以记载代码的修正历史,繁难团队单干和代码治理。

编程是一个宽泛而深化的技术畛域,触及多种言语和工具的经常使用,以及软件开发的全环节。

除了把握编程言语和工具之外,开发者还须要了解算法、数据结构、软件开发流程、调试测试以及版本控制等外容。

这些内容都是编程中无法或缺的局部,关于成为一名低劣的开发者来说,都须要启动学习和把握。

写代码用什么软件

敲代码用的软件有:Android studio,WebStorm,Intellij IDEA,source inshght,Vscode。

1、Android studio

对UI界面设计和编写代码有更好地允许,可以繁难地调整设施上的多种分辨率。

雷同允许ProGuard工具和运行签名。

不过,目前版本的Android Studio不能在同一窗口中治理多个名目。

2、WebStorm

jetbrains公司旗下一款Javascript开发工具。

目前曾经被广阔中国JS开发者誉为“Web前端开发神器”、“最弱小的HTML5编辑器”、“最智能的Javascript IDE”等。

与IntelliJ IDEA同源,承袭了IntelliJ IDEA弱小的JS局部的配置。 编程包含哪些

不过,我的粉丝说这个有点卡,然而配置还是完全的。

3、Intellij IDEA

Intellij IDEA是java编程言语开发的集成环境,在业界内也被公认是比拟好的一个java开发工具。

4、source inshght

一个面向名目开发的程序编辑器和代码阅读器,它领有内置的对C/C++,C#和Java等程序的剖析。

Source Insight能剖析你的源代码并在你上班的同时灵活保养它自己的符号数据库,并智能为你显示有用的高低文消息。

Source Insight提供了最极速的对源代码的导航和任何程序编辑器的源消息。

Vscode全称Visual Studio Code,是一款针关于编写现代web和云运行的跨平台源代码编辑器。

开发软件的软件有哪些?普通又由什么编程言语来编写?

java开发工具

1、MyEclipse(MyEclipseEnterpriseWorkbench)

MyEclipse运行开发平台是J2EE集成开发环境,包含了完备的编码、调试、测试和颁布配置,完整允许HTML,Struts,JSF,CSS,Javascript,SQL,Hibernate。

MyEclipse运行开发平台结构上成功Eclipse单个配置部件的模块化,并可以有选用性的对独自的模块启动裁减和更新。

Eclipse是目前配置比拟弱小的JAVAIDE(JAVA编程软件),是一个集成工具的开明平台,而这些工具关键是一些开源工具软件。

在一个开源形式下运作,并遵循独特的公共条款,Eclipse平台为工具软件开发者提供工具开发的灵敏性和控制自己软件的技术。

3、NetBeans

NetBeans是开明源码的Java集成开发环境(IDE),实用于各种客户机和Web运行。

SunJavaStudio是Sun公司最新颁布的商用全配置JavaIDE,允许Solaris、Linux和Windows平台,适于创立和部署2层JavaWeb运行和n层J2EE运行的企业开发人员经常使用。

软件开发工具

1、MicrosoftVisualStudio

VisualStudio是一套完整的开发工具,用于生成ASPNETWeb运行程序、XMLWebservices、桌面运行程序和移动运行程序。

VisualBasic、VisualC#和VisualC++都经常使用相反的集成开发环境(IDE),这样就能够启开工具共享,并能够轻松地创立混合言语处置打算。

关于罕用的软件开发工具。

经常出现的软件开发言语:JAVA、、C/C++/C#、JSP、ASP、PHP等等多种言语。

其中PHP、Java和曾经成为了未来五年内程序员必定具有的技艺,这三种言语都在Web开发畛域占有一席之地。

PHP是Web的脚本言语;Java配置弱小,适宜企业级编程言语;C#融合了几种言语的好处。

相关内容

热门资讯

什... 本文目录导航: 什么是区块链技术 什么是区块链技术 区块链...
便... 本文目录导航: 便捷地解释一下什么是区块链?举个例子! 深刻解读什么是区块...
S... 本文目录导航: 智能合约编写之 Solidity 的基础个性 | 区块链 ...
共... 本文目录导航: 区块链是 、点对点传输、共识机制、加密算法等计算机技术新型运行形式。 ...
深... 本文目录导航: 「MXC抹茶征文」深化了解MXC买卖所 gala币上哪几个...
区... 本文目录导航: 区块链买卖所合法吗? 区块链合法买卖指什么(区块链合法买卖...
浏... 本文目录导航: 浏览荟区块链是什么? 区块链是示意什么深刻 ...
区... 本文目录导航: 区块链入门的教程 区块链游戏前端用什么言语(区块链游戏开发...
区... 本文目录导航: 区块链务工薪资大略是多少? 区块链的职位有哪些? ...
v... 本文目录导航: vr虚构事实游戏设施大略多少钱?vr设施费用是多少? vr...
v... 本文目录导航: vr哪个牌子做得比拟好 av 公司有哪些 ...
什... 本文目录导航: 什么是虚构事实技术 什么是虚构事实技术 什...
漫... 本文目录导航: 漫画介绍 漂亮新环球韩漫是原创吗 有什么虚...
g... 本文目录导航: glworld是什么意思? vr技术是什么意思 ...
虚... 本文目录导航: 虚拟理想技术与增强理想技术的区别是什么 增强理想和虚拟理想...
A... 本文目录导航: AR技术和VR技术区分指什么 AR技术和VR技术区分指什么...
虚... 本文目录导航: 虚构事实技术运行专业务工前景如何啊 虚构事实技术务工方向及...
人... 本文目录导航: 虚构事实技术(VR)重要包含模拟环境、感知、人造技艺和传感设施等方面。其可...
如... 本文目录导航: 如何辨别AR和VR间的不同 VR和AR的区别 ...
什... 本文目录导航: 什么是AR和VR ar和vr哪个更有前景 ...